NIGERIA AIRFORCE ONLINE REGISTRATION GUIDELINES 2013

Application Guidelines

PLEASE READ THE INSTRUCTIONS CAREFULLY

Online Registration Starts 21st January 2013 and Closes on 18th March 2013.

GENERAL INSTRUCTIONS
  1. Nationality: Applicant must be of Nigerian origin.
  2. Age: Applicants must be between the ages of 17 and 22 years for non-tradesmen/women, 17 and 24 years for tradesmen/women by 31st December 2013.
    Those who will be older than 22 and 24 years for non-tradesmen and tradesmen respectively by 31st December 2013 need not apply.

  3. Marital Status: All applicants must be single.
  4. Height: Minimum height is 1.68 meters or 5.5ft for males and 1.65m or 5.4ft for females.
  5. Medical Fitness: All applicants must be medically fit and meet the Nigerian Air Force medical and employment standards.
  6. Applicants with HND or First Degrees/Post-Graduate Certificates, University Diplomas and Grade II Teacher’s certificates will not be considered for recruitment as airmen/airwomen into the Nigerian Air Force.
  7. Applicant's attestation form must be signed by a military officer from the same state as the applicant and not below the rank of Squadron Leader or equivalent in the Nigerian Army and the Nigerian Navy, and Police Officer of the rank of Assistant CP and above. Local Governments Chairmen/Secretaries, magistrates and principals of government Secondary Schools from applicants’ state of origin can also sign the attestation forms. In addition, applicants are to bring with them a letter of attestation of good character from any of the officers above to the Zonal Recruitment Centers and final selection interview.
  8. Educational Qualification.
Non-Trade
  1. Applicants must possess a minimum of 5 credits including Mathematics and English Language at not more than 2 sittings obtained not later than 4 years to this exercise. In addition, all applicants are also required to possess their school's testimonials.
Tradesmen/women
  1. Applicants must satisfy the requirements stated for Non-Trade above. In addition, applicants applying as tradesmen/tradeswomen must possess ND (with minimum of Lower Credit) or other relevant trade qualification from government-approved institutions. Applicant with University Diploma need not apply.
    Applicants are advised to carefully read the requirements below before filling the form:
  1. Medical Records: ND in Medical Records.
  2. Nursing: RN-RM.
  3. Lab Technician: ND in Lab Tech/Medical Lab tech.
  4. X-Ray Technicians: ND/Certificate in X-ray Technology.
  5. Dental Technician: ND in Dental Technology/Dental Therapy.
  6. Pharmacy Technician: ND Pharmacy Technology.
  7. Environmental Technician: ND Environmental Technology.
  8. Biomed Technician: ND Biomed Technology.
  9. Optometry Technician: ND Optometry Technology.
  10. Statistics: ND Maths/Stats.
  11. Assistant Chaplain: ND in Christian Religious Study.
  12. Assistant Imam: ND in Arabic/Islamic Studies.
  13. Engineering Technicians: ND in Mechanical Engr./Electrical Electronics Engr./Air Engineering Technology. 
  14. Meteorologist: ND in Meteorology.
  15. Electrical Technicians: ND Electrical Electronics, ND/Trade Test Cert in Domestic Elect.
  16. Building Technology: ND/C&G in building tech/Draughtsman/C&G/Trade Test in Survey Assistants/Land Surveying/ND Quantity Surveying.
  17. Public Relations/Info: ND Mass Comm. Cert/Trade Test Cert in Videography/Photography.
  18. Secretarial Assistants: ND in Office Technology Management/Purchasing and Supply/Personnel Mgt/Human Resource Mgt.
  19. Library Assistants: ND in Library Science.
  20. Music: ND in Music from Government approved institutions. In addition, playing experience in any recognised Band will be an advantage.
  21. Driver/Mechanic: Trade Test and current driver's license with practical experience.
  22. Works: C&G Trade Test Cert in Welding/Carpentry/Painting/Sign Writing/Plumbing/Mason/domestic Electrician/Refrigeration and Air Conditioning.
  23. Computer Tech: ND/Cert in Computer Hardware Engr/Software Engr.
  24. ND/Cert in Physiotherapy
  25. ND/Cert in Medical Supply.
  26. ND/Printing Technology.
  27. PE/Sports: ND  in Physical Education, Certificate of participation/Medals.
  28. Catering: ND in Catering Services.

  1. Qualifying Recruitment Tests will hold in the following Centers:
    1. Makurdi: Nigerian Air Force Base, Markudi
    2. Ilorin: 227 Wing, Nigerian Air Force, Ilorin
    3. Lagos: Sam Ethnan Air Force Base, Ikeja – Lagos
    4. Enugu: 305 Flying Training School, Enugu
    5. Port-Harcourt: 97 Special Operations Group, Nigerian Air Force, Port-Harcourt
    6. Benin: 81 Air Maritime Group, Nigerian Air Force, Benin.
    7. Kaduna: Nigerian Air Force Base, Kawo – Kaduna
    8. Kano: 303 Flying Training School, Kano
    9. Maiduguri: 204 Wing, Nigerian Air Force Base, Maiduguri
    10. Akure: 323 Artillery Regiment, Owena Barracks, Akure
    11. Sokoto: 55 forward Operation Base Mabera Sokoto
    12. Yola: 75 Strike Group, Nigerian Air Force, Yola
  2. All applicants will be required to submit for scrutiny, the original copies of the documents listed under Paragraph 9(b) at the recruitment centers and during the final selection interview. Applicants will be required to present following documents if selected for the zonal recruitment test:
    1. Two recent passport size photographs to be stamped and countersigned by officer of appropriate rank specified, Local Government Chairmen/Secretaries and other specified officers in Paragraph 7.
    2.  Photocopies of:
      • (I) Birth Certificate or Declaration of Age (Any age declaration done less than 5 years to this exercise will not be acceptable).
      • (II) Educational and Trade Certificates 
  3. Any applicant suspected to have impersonated or submitted false document(s) shall be disqualified from the selection exercise. Also any false declaration detected later may lead to withdrawal from training. Such applicants may be handed over to the Police for prosecution.
  4. The Nigerian Air Force will not entertain any enquiries in respect of applicants whose applications have been rejected.
